Yes, you're right, the Due is hard-configured for little-endian. I mis-remembered, as I have not used a Due in many years. But the rest still holds - the endian-ness of ARM processors is selectable, and has been for 20+ years, going all the way back to the "Thumb" processors of the '90s. That includes the current CORTEX-M series, which, unlike earlier versions, allow endian-ness can only be configured when the processor logic is synthesized during the chip design process. Earlier models allowed endian-ness to be configured at run-time, usually via a configuration pin.
